Tufts University dominates the landscape with its hilltop campus straddling city borders. The Royall House and Slave Quarters offers a powerful historical narrative that many American towns conveniently forget. Escape to Middlesex Fells Reservation where hiking trails wind through forests surprisingly untamed for being so close to Boston. Medford Square serves up local flavor in unpretentious eateries where students debate philosophy over coffee. The Mystic River provides a peaceful backdrop for contemplative walks along its banks. Sports enthusiasts can catch local games or head to nearby Fenway Park for the quintessential Boston experience. Old Ship Street Historic District reveals architectural treasures from an era when shipbuilding, not academia, defined this riverside community.

What will the weather in Medford be like during my trip?
July and August are typically the warmest months in Medford when the average temp is 70°F. January and February are the coldest months when the average temperature is 33°F. December and October are the months with the most rain.
